Check Out the 2023 RKCC Open House - Sept. 23

We are excited to announce our RKCC Open House on Saturday, Sept 23rd


Different from past experiences, we have developed a fun-filled family day to help introduce

the Club and our favourite sport to the Kingston Community.


As part of this FREE event, there will be live acoustic music, bouncy castles, food trucks, face

painting and more! We will also be fundraising for some initiatives in our Club, so come down and try dunking our President and other long-term members with our mini ‘dunk-tank’, AND to give you another reason to pop by, drinks will be $5 all day long.


Event Timing:

Day: Open House: 10am-6pm

Evening: Open House Party (19+): Doors Open 8pm, Cover Band from 9pm-12pm

Bring your husband, wife, neighbour, best friend, grandkids, nieces, nephews, or whoever has said “Curling looks easy” or “I’ve always wanted to try it!”.


Beginners can sign up for an hour time slot, where they will learn the basics and get 30 minutes on-Ice time to try throwing rocks, and get an overall better sense of the sport. One sheet will be fully dedicated to Juniors all day long! We welcome individuals, pairs, or groups of 4. (32adults + 8-12 juniors per hour). Greater Kingston Curling | Kingston Curls also known as The Greater Kingston & Area Curling Association represents Kingston and area curling clubs. The association is administered by a Board of Directors and is entirely volunteer governed. The Association’s structure is that of a Non-profit Organization. The association was founded in 2012 in preparation to host the 2013 Scotties Tournament of Hearts in Kingston.
